Transaction 4bf122de5a24949385e1e45b95af5a56051bb0132c80a0d135668f7b57def717
1 Input
1 Outputs
- 4bf122de5a24949385e1e45b95af5a56051bb0132c80a0d135668f7b57def717:0
value 309624
address 383GbDR4WSAHNoBRjy2f9RagNeaXcYsnDZ